Linux开发:一触即发的技术之旅(什么是linux开发)

Linux开发:一触即发的技术之旅

Linux是一种可以自由使用的开源的的操作系统,它被用于存储和控制各种类型的文件、内存和资源。它通过允许用户访问和浏览文件、内存和资源,来实现某些任务和功能,为复杂的操作和应用程序创建一个稳定的运行环境。因此,Linux发展非常快,受到许多开发社区的欢迎和支持,这些社区构建了一些强大的技术,为开发者提供了更宽松和灵活的开发语言和开发框架,使他们能够开发出更加先进的应用。

Linux的开发方式主要是在命令行中运行脚本,并使用特定的语言和工具来实现应用程序开发。例如,BASH和Python可以用作Linux应用程序的开发语言,这些语言提供了强大的功能,例如更好地处理内存、文件和进程等操作,可以帮助解决Linux操作系统中的偶发错误。

此外,Linux开发者还可以使用框架来快速实现功能。框架在提供常见功能的同时还可以提高程序的运行速度和效率。例如,Flask框架可以帮助构建网站,Django框架可以帮助构建Web应用程序,这些框架可以为开发者提供便利,让他们可以花更少的时间和精力来实现其目标应用程序。

此外,Linux也提供强大的API,可以帮助应用程序从核心的硬件中访问服务,从而为高级应用程序提供先进的功能。例如,一些API可以实现与硬件和外部设备的连接,还可以实现高级网络功能,如实时传输,安全性,高级数据报文等。

此外,Linux也具有许多类似其他开发平台的特性,使得开发者可以利用各种工具,快速地完成开发工作,提高其开发效率,从而实现其背后的任务和目标。

总之,Linux的开发环境对开发者来说是一个触碰即发的技术之旅,从其强大的语言技术和框架,到诸如API、设备和网络等高级功能,Linux已经为开发者提供了一个稳定和方便的编程环境。


数据运维技术 » Linux开发:一触即发的技术之旅(什么是linux开发)